Abstract

The method is for cascading two triacs (1, 2). The triacs are connected head to tail by the principal opposite electrodes (A, A1). One control voltage or current simultaneously triggers them according to differing biassing modes, such that the polarities of their triggers (G, G1) are different with respect to the polarities of their respective first principal electrodes. A static switch comprising two triacs (1, 2) in series is characterised in that the two triacs are connected by their first principal electrodes (A, A1) and that a control signal is applied in parallel to the two triggers (G, G1) via intermediate balancing impedances (3, 4. Alternative arrangements include a divert connection to the triacs without the balancing impedances and a system with a diagonal connection.
